Fairings, Tourpacks, Baggers, Post your pics here!
Unless they have changed recently the Ultra Classics were the only bikes that came with the tailights in them, and now the new Road Glide Ultra as well. The side marker lights were available on Electra Glides as an extra. I don't have any lights on my box. You could buy them and cut them in but that would cost a fair bit from the prices Ive seen them selling for.
Also my box just has a rubber mat in the bottom, whereas the Ultras have a full molded carpet liner. Fairings, Tourpacks, Baggers, Post your pics here!
Ultra Classic, Which is HD full touring bike, which has lowers, CB radio, etc. Like Ringadingh said, if it doersnt have the light kit, then it probabley came off their Eletra Glide. The light kit was only on their Ultra Classic, unless the person paid extra on the Eletra Glide to have them added
I also know you can buy the light kit on the rear off Ebay, which is what a friend of mine did with his HD tour pack HD also made smaller half trunks, with no lights |
